Abstract
Within contemporary educational transformation movements, STEM pedagogy emerges as an integrated instructional framework that increasingly captures worldwide academic attention and implementation. Adopting STEM principles represents a prevailing direction in modern educational advancement and institutional change. Tertiary education maintains a crucial role within national academic structures, serving as a fundamental catalyst for modernization initiatives and sustained societal progress. Incorporating STEM methodologies into university curricula not only facilitates pedagogical transformation but also enhances holistic student growth, strengthens their multifaceted capabilities, and delivers skilled professionals for national development. As society progressively transitions into an accelerated digital era, nations intensify their efforts in cultivating advanced specialists to enhance overall capacity and global competitive positioning. Academic institutions continuously investigate innovative instructional approaches to pursue excellence in educational delivery. Considering these circumstances, this study, grounded in STEM educational principles, presents a concise overview of the imperative for incorporating STEM pedagogy into university instruction. Subsequently, it proposes concrete teaching methodologies to examine how tertiary education transformation and advancement can be achieved through STEM educational guidance, with the intention that this investigation offers valuable insights for educational practitioners.
